Preparing the Surface for Painting

When it comes to painting your bathroom, the most important step is preparing the surface before you even pick up a paintbrush. If you’re not careful about preparing the surface, your paint won’t stick properly and the finish won’t last. To ensure that your bathroom paint job looks great and lasts for years to come, you need to take the time to properly prep the surface before you start painting.

Start by removing any existing wallpaper from the walls. This can be done using a wallpaper steamer, a wallpaper removal solution, or a combination of both. Once the wallpaper is removed, you should sand the walls to create a smooth and even surface. If there are any holes or cracks, fill them in with spackle or a similar product. If the walls are overly glossy, use a slightly abrasive sponge to remove the gloss. Once the walls are prepped, give them a good cleaning to remove any dust and debris.

After the walls are clean and dry, it’s time to start painting. Before you start painting, it’s important to prime the walls. Primer helps the paint stick to the surface and ensures that the color will be even and consistent. Once the primer is dry, it’s time to pick out the paint color. Select a paint that is designed for high-humidity rooms like bathrooms and kitchens. This will help ensure that the finish will last for years to come.

Choosing the Right Sheen for Your Bathroom

When painting your bathroom, selecting the right finish is key to achieving the desired look and feel. But with so many different paint sheens available, knowing which one is best for your space can be difficult. To help you make the right decision, we’ve outlined the most commonly used paint finishes and their benefits.

Flat/Matte will give your bathroom a warm, muted look and is ideal for hiding imperfections in the wall. Its low reflection means it’s also very easy to clean. Eggshell is slightly more durable and shinier than flat/matte, making it a great choice for bathrooms that get a lot of use. Satin has a glossy, slightly reflective finish that is still easy to clean but also adds a bit of shine. Semi-gloss is a good option for areas of high moisture as it is highly resistant to water and stains. High gloss is the most durable option and is great for brightening up dark bathrooms, but it does require more maintenance.

No matter the finish you decide to go with, make sure you use quality paint and primer specifically designed for bathrooms. This will ensure your paint job lasts for years to come.

Cost Considerations for Different Paint Finishes

When it comes to bathroom paint finishes, the cost of the project can vary significantly depending on the type of paint you choose. While there are many different paint finishes to choose from, the most popular options are satin, semi-gloss, and high-gloss. Each of these finishes comes with its own set of advantages and disadvantages, and each will have a different cost associated with it.

Satin paint is a popular choice for bathrooms due to its ability to resist moisture, making it a great choice for bathrooms with high humidity. On the downside, it’s not the most durable option, and it can be difficult to clean. Satin paint typically costs between $30-60 per gallon.

Semi-gloss paint is more durable and easier to clean than satin, but it’s also more expensive. It typically costs between $35-70 per gallon. Semi-gloss paint is a good choice for bathrooms that need a bit more protection from moisture and wear and tear.

High-gloss paint is the most durable and long-lasting option, and it’s also the most expensive. It’s especially well-suited to bathrooms that see a lot of traffic and need to be cleaned often. High-gloss paint typically costs between $50-100 per gallon.

FAQs About the Bathroom Paint Finish

1. What kind of paint finish should I use for my bathroom walls?

A: The best paint finish for bathrooms is a semi-gloss or gloss finish. These finishes are more resistant to moisture and humidity, which is necessary for the high-humidity environment of a bathroom.

2. How many coats of paint should I use for my bathroom walls?

A: Generally, two coats of paint are recommended for bathrooms. The first coat will serve as a primer and the second coat will provide the desired finish.

3. What is the most durable paint finish for my bathroom walls?

A: The most durable finish for bathrooms is a high-gloss or semi-gloss finish. These finishes will provide the best protection against moisture and humidity.
